New Found Glory And Simple Plan Announce Pop Punk’s Still Not Dead Tour with Knuckle Puck

Just one day after announcing their 10th full-length album Forever + Ever x Infinity, pop-punk veterans New Found Glory have returned with even more exciting news. 

Today, the band has announced a massive co-headlining tour with Simple Plan dubbed the Pop Punk’s Still Not Dead Tour. Featuring additional support from Knuckle Puck, the 19-date summer trek kicks off May 29th in St. Petersburg, FL and wraps up June 28th in Austin, TX.
